I've been having a problem with my X700 I bought a few months ago, runs fine and all except it seems the ball bearing in the fan is dying, making quite whirling in-consistant noises. And I'd just like to know where I can get a decent after market cooler for it. This is a picture of what my card looks like, except mines PCI-Express and is a X700, the cooling fan and heatsink looks to be the exact thing.

Reason why I need help finding one, I live in Canada, and I find it hard to find to many retailers. I usually use TigerDirect, but they don't have any GPU coolers.
